Re: headaches and nausia
Posted by: Jgunn ()
Date: May 23, 2007 03:53PM

ok i had to guesstimate somethings but i put into fitday

2 medium apples (not sure how big yours were)
2 medium pears (not sure how big yours were)
1 banana (not sure how big yours were)
1 whole pineappe (not sure how big yours was)
2 salads (mixed greens , any dressing?)
honey (1 tablespoon per mug)

this total gives you

Total: 799 calories
grams cals %total
Fat: 5 49 6%
Sat: 1 6 1%
Poly: 2 15 2%
Mono: 1 6 1%
Carbs: 202 694 89%
Fiber: 29 0 0%
Protein: 8 34 4%
Alcohol: 0 0 0%

that doesnt seem like very much for a full day .. mind you i dont know what you do all day long either ... if yer a sitting alot or chasing after kids or running a marathon hehe smiling smiley

but even if you sat doing nothing all day .. 800 calories is not a whole lotta food ...i would suspect your headache is from detoxing quite quickly on so little food

adding a bit more food till your comfortable should slow down the headache smiling smiley
